How AI Redefines Customer Discovery Mechanisms

The real bottleneck is 'cognitive lag'—while businesses still match keywords to needs, AI can detect professional purchasing intent in milliseconds. Gartner's 2024 report indicates that AI adoption in industrial goods transactions has grown by 67% annually, yet 90% of companies use it only for chatbots, missing out on the strategic value of multimodal semantic understanding.

Breakthroughs come from three-layer collaboration: Data Perception Layer integrates unstructured signals like customs flows, patent filings, and technical forums; Intent Recognition Layer uses NLP to parse latent demands—for example, when a factory frequently searches for specific precision parameters, it may signal an impending production-line upgrade; Contact Optimization Layer automatically schedules emails or local agents to engage customers early in their decision-making process. One laser equipment vendor reduced its lead-to-conversion cycle by 42% and increased the share of high-intent leads to 68%. This means AI no longer merely responds to queries—it actively shapes the procurement agenda.

Five Steps to Successfully Implement AI-Based Overseas Expansion

If you fail to launch an AI-driven lead-generation system within six months, many companies will miss the 2025 growth window. Existing channel-based acquisition costs have already risen by 47% (according to the 2024 Global B2B Marketing Benchmark Report), whereas AI-powered intelligent lead generation can compress conversion cycles to one-third of traditional approaches.

  • Build an Export Product Knowledge Graph: Integrate technical specs with application scenarios to help machines understand pain points behind selling points;
  • Integrate Overseas Sentiment Monitoring APIs: Capture regional market sentiment fluctuations in real-time to anticipate demand inflection points;
  • Train Industry-Specific Large Models: Adapt AI to truly comprehend specialized contexts such as industrial pumps, valves, and motors;
  • Deploy Cross-Platform Outreach Engines: Automatically deliver personalized content on LinkedIn, ExportHub, and other platforms;
  • Establish A/B Testing Optimization Mechanisms: Iteratively refine messaging and channel combinations weekly.

For cold starts, focus on 'high-potential, low-competition' segments, such as Southeast Asia's new energy equipment parts market.
